Exodus 28:1“Bring Aaron your brother, and his sons with him, near to you from among the children of Israel, that he may minister to me in the priest’s office, even Aaron, Nadab and Abihu, Eleazar and Ithamar, Aaron’s sons.Exodus 29:9You shall clothe them with belts, Aaron and his sons, and bind headbands on them: and they shall have the priesthood by a perpetual statute: and you shall consecrate Aaron and his sons.Exodus 32:26then Moses stood in the gate of the camp, and said, “Whoever is on Yahweh’s side, come to me!” All the sons of Levi gathered themselves together to him.Exodus 32:27He said to them, “Thus says Yahweh, the God of Israel, ‘Every man put his sword on his thigh, and go back and forth from gate to gate throughout the camp, and every man kill his brother, and every man his companion, and every man his neighbor.’”Exodus 32:28The sons of Levi did according to the word of Moses: and there fell of the people that day about three thousand men.Leviticus 25:32“‘Nevertheless the cities of the Levites, the houses in the cities of their possession, the Levites may redeem at any time.Leviticus 25:33The Levites may redeem the house that was sold, and the city of his possession, and it shall be released in the Jubilee; for the houses of the cities of the Levites are their possession among the children of Israel.Leviticus 25:34But the field of the suburbs of their cities may not be sold; for it is their perpetual possession.Numbers 1:47But the Levites after the tribe of their fathers were not numbered among them.Numbers 1:48For Yahweh spoke to Moses, saying,Numbers 1:49“Only the tribe of Levi you shall not number, neither shall you take a census of them among the children of Israel;Numbers 1:50but appoint the Levites over the Tabernacle of the Testimony, and over all its furnishings, and over all that belongs to it. They shall carry the tabernacle, and all its furnishings; and they shall take care of it, and shall encamp around it.Numbers 1:51When the tabernacle is to move, the Levites shall take it down; and when the tabernacle is to be set up, the Levites shall set it up. The stranger who comes near shall be put to death.Numbers 1:52The children of Israel shall pitch their tents, every man by his own camp, and every man by his own standard, according to their divisions.Numbers 1:53But the Levites shall encamp around the Tabernacle of the Testimony, that there may be no wrath on the congregation of the children of Israel: and the Levites shall be responsible for the Tabernacle of the Testimony.”Numbers 1:54Thus the children of Israel did. According to all that Yahweh commanded Moses, so they did.Numbers 2:17“Then the Tent of Meeting shall set out, with the camp of the Levites in the midst of the camps. As they encamp, so shall they set out, every man in his place, by their standards.Numbers 2:33But the Levites were not numbered among the children of Israel; as Yahweh commanded Moses.Numbers 3:6“Bring the tribe of Levi near, and set them before Aaron the priest, that they may minister to him.Numbers 3:7They shall keep his requirements, and the requirements of the whole congregation before the Tent of Meeting, to do the service of the tabernacle.Numbers 3:8They shall keep all the furnishings of the Tent of Meeting, and the obligations of the children of Israel, to do the service of the tabernacle.Numbers 3:9You shall give the Levites to Aaron and to his sons. They are wholly given to him on the behalf of the children of Israel.Numbers 3:10You shall appoint Aaron and his sons, and they shall keep their priesthood. The stranger who comes near shall be put to death.”Numbers 3:11Yahweh spoke to Moses, saying,Numbers 3:12“Behold, I have taken the Levites from among the children of Israel instead of all the firstborn who open the womb among the children of Israel; and the Levites shall be mine:Numbers 3:13for all the firstborn are mine. On the day that I struck down all the firstborn in the land of Egypt I made holy to me all the firstborn in Israel, both man and animal. They shall be mine. I am Yahweh.”Numbers 3:14Yahweh spoke to Moses in the wilderness of Sinai, saying,Numbers 3:15“Count the children of Levi by their fathers’ houses, by their families. You shall count every male from a month old and upward.”Numbers 3:16Moses numbered them according to the word of Yahweh, as he was commanded.Numbers 3:17These were the sons of Levi by their names: Gershon, and Kohath, and Merari.Numbers 3:18These are the names of the sons of Gershon by their families: Libni and Shimei.Numbers 3:19The sons of Kohath by their families: Amram, and Izhar, Hebron, and Uzziel.Numbers 3:20The sons of Merari by their families: Mahli and Mushi. These are the families of the Levites according to their fathers’ houses.Numbers 3:21Of Gershon was the family of the Libnites, and the family of the Shimeites: these are the families of the Gershonites.Numbers 3:22Those who were numbered of them, according to the number of all the males, from a month old and upward, even those who were numbered of them were seven thousand five hundred.Numbers 3:23The families of the Gershonites shall encamp behind the tabernacle westward.Numbers 3:24The prince of the fathers’ house of the Gershonites shall be Eliasaph the son of Lael.Numbers 3:25The duty of the sons of Gershon in the Tent of Meeting shall be the tabernacle, and the tent, its covering, and the screen for the door of the Tent of Meeting,Numbers 3:26and the hangings of the court, and the screen for the door of the court, which is by the tabernacle, and around the altar, and its cords for all of its service.Numbers 3:27Of Kohath was the family of the Amramites, and the family of the Izharites, and the family of the Hebronites, and the family of the Uzzielites: these are the families of the Kohathites.Numbers 3:28According to the number of all the males, from a month old and upward, there were eight thousand six hundred, keeping the requirements of the sanctuary.Numbers 3:29The families of the sons of Kohath shall encamp on the south side of the tabernacle.Numbers 3:30The prince of the fathers’ house of the families of the Kohathites shall be Elizaphan the son of Uzziel.Numbers 3:31Their duty shall be the ark, the table, the lamp stand, the altars, the vessels of the sanctuary with which they minister, and the screen, and all its service.Numbers 3:32Eleazar the son of Aaron the priest shall be prince of the princes of the Levites, with the oversight of those who keep the requirements of the sanctuary.Numbers 3:33Of Merari was the family of the Mahlites, and the family of the Mushites. These are the families of Merari.Numbers 3:34Those who were numbered of them, according to the number of all the males, from a month old and upward, were six thousand two hundred.Numbers 3:35The prince of the fathers’ house of the families of Merari was Zuriel the son of Abihail. They shall encamp on the north side of the tabernacle.Numbers 3:36The appointed duty of the sons of Merari shall be the tabernacle’s boards, its bars, its pillars, its sockets, all its instruments, all its service,Numbers 3:37the pillars of the court around it, their sockets, their pins, and their cords.Numbers 3:38Those who encamp before the tabernacle eastward, in front of the Tent of Meeting toward the sunrise, shall be Moses, and Aaron and his sons, keeping the requirements of the sanctuary for the duty of the children of Israel. The stranger who comes near shall be put to death.Numbers 3:39All who were numbered of the Levites, whom Moses and Aaron numbered at the commandment of Yahweh, by their families, all the males from a month old and upward, were twenty-two thousand.Numbers 3:41You shall take the Levites for me (I am Yahweh) instead of all the firstborn among the children of Israel; and the livestock of the Levites instead of all the firstborn among the livestock of the children of Israel.”Numbers 3:42Moses numbered, as Yahweh commanded him, all the firstborn among the children of Israel.Numbers 3:43All the firstborn males according to the number of names, from a month old and upward, of those who were numbered of them, were twenty-two thousand two hundred seventy-three.Numbers 3:44Yahweh spoke to Moses, saying,Numbers 3:45“Take the Levites instead of all the firstborn among the children of Israel, and the livestock of the Levites instead of their livestock; and the Levites shall be mine. I am Yahweh.Numbers 4:1Yahweh spoke to Moses and to Aaron, saying,Numbers 4:2“Take a census of the sons of Kohath from among the sons of Levi, by their families, by their fathers’ houses,Numbers 4:3from thirty years old and upward even until fifty years old, all who enter into the service, to do the work in the Tent of Meeting.
